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about dermatology services in Lynchburg, South Carolina

How can I find a dermatologist in Lynchburg, South Carolina, and are there practices located directly in town?

While Lynchburg itself is a small town, residents typically access dermatology services in nearby larger cities such as Florence, Sumter, or Columbia. You can find local providers by searching online directories, asking for referrals from your primary care physician at the Lynchburg Medical Center, or contacting your insurance company for a list of in-network dermatologists within a reasonable driving distance.

What are the most common dermatology services available to residents of Lynchburg, SC?

Dermatologists serving the Lynchburg area typically offer comprehensive skin cancer screenings (vital for South Carolina's sunny climate), treatment for acne and eczema, and procedures like mole removal and biopsies. Many also provide treatment for sun damage, rashes, and skin infections commonly seen in the region.

What should I know about insurance and payment options when visiting a dermatologist near Lynchburg?

It is crucial to verify that both the dermatology practice and the specific provider are in-network with your insurance plan before scheduling an appointment, as you will likely be traveling outside Lynchburg for care. Most practices in the surrounding areas accept major insurance plans, Medicare, and offer self-pay options or payment plans for those without coverage.

How far in advance do I need to schedule a routine dermatology appointment, and what are typical wait times for the Lynchburg area?

For a routine skin check or non-urgent concern, you should plan to schedule an appointment several weeks to a few months in advance, as dermatology services in the region can have high demand. Wait times can vary, so it's advisable to call multiple practices in the broader area (like in Bishopville or Hartsville) to find the earliest available slot.

Is there access to emergency dermatology care for severe issues like a spreading infection or severe rash in Lynchburg?

For true dermatological emergencies, such as a severe allergic reaction or a rapidly spreading infection, you should proceed to the nearest emergency room, such as McLeod Health Cheraw or a facility in Florence. For urgent but non-life-threatening issues, contact dermatology practices in neighboring cities to inquire about same-day or next-day sick visit availability.

Advanced Dermatology in Lynchburg, SC: Modern Care for Your Southern Skin

Living in Lynchburg, South Carolina, means enjoying beautiful landscapes and a rich community spirit. However, our local climate, with its humid summers and seasonal shifts, presents unique challenges for our skin. From increased sun exposure during long, bright days to humidity that can exacerbate certain conditions, having access to advanced dermatology is more than a luxury—it’s a key part of maintaining your health and confidence right here in our community. Modern dermatology has moved far beyond basic treatments, offering sophisticated solutions tailored to individual needs.

Advanced dermatology encompasses the latest technologies and techniques for diagnosing, treating, and preventing skin conditions. For us in Lynchburg, this means having options that are both highly effective and minimally disruptive to our daily lives. Think of procedures like precision laser treatments for sun spots and vascular lesions caused by years of Southern sun, or state-of-the-art skin cancer screenings using digital dermoscopy that can detect the earliest signs of trouble. These tools allow for earlier, more accurate interventions, which is crucial for conditions like melanoma, where early detection saves lives.

Many skin concerns prevalent in our area can be addressed with these advanced approaches. For instance, the humidity can worsen conditions like acne and rosacea, while our active, outdoor lifestyles might lead to concerns like precancerous actinic keratoses or persistent rashes. An advanced dermatology practice can offer targeted solutions such as customized topical regimens, advanced light-based therapies to reduce redness and inflammation, and even biologic injections for severe conditions like psoriasis. These treatments are designed to provide better results with greater comfort and shorter recovery times than older methods.
